When is the best time to visit Builth Wells?
Visiting local bars in Builth Wells is better when the weather is good. These temperatures and rainfall averages can help you choose the best time for bar-hopping.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 4°C. Average annual precipitation for Builth Wells is 1196 mm.
How can I get to Builth Wells and around the area?
You might want to make the most of these transportation options in and around Builth Wells: Fly into Cardiff International Airport (CWL), which is located 51.9 mi (83.6 km) from the city centre. To explore the surrounding area, hop aboard a train at Builth Road Station or Cilmeri Station.
